    Awe, If he doesn't act this way often, I wouldn't worry too much about it. I bet if ever I were in your position I would probably feel a little jealous too. Try not to let your mind get ahead of you too much though. Maybe you were feeling a little too paranoid. You should be open and honest with him about it. You might be a little hesitant to ask him what he was whispering to her, because you probably don't want to cause tension, and make him think you're needy, and that's understandable. But if it bothers you that bad you should talk to him about it regardless. You probably should get it off your chest.
